otRadioCoexMetrics

#include <radio.h>

ये मान्य रेडियो स्थिति ट्रांज़िशन हैं:

खास जानकारी

(रेडियो चालू है) +----+ चालू करें() +-+ रिसीव करें() +---+ ट्रांसमिट() +----+ | | _______>| | - कॉपीराइट | |

आईईईई 802.15.4 डेटा अनुरोध के दौरान, अगर प्लैटफ़ॉर्म OT_Radio_CAPS_SLEEP_TO_TX की सुविधा के साथ काम करता है, तो स्लीप->पाएं->ट्रांसफ़र को डायरेक्ट ट्रांज़िशन से स्लीप मोड में ट्रांसफ़र करने के लिए छोटा किया जा सकता है. यह रेडियो को एक साथ काम करने से जुड़ी मेट्रिक के बारे में बताता है.

सार्वजनिक एट्रिब्यूट

mAvgRxRequestToGrantTime
uint32_t
देने के लिए rx अनुरोध के उपयोगc में औसत समय.
mAvgTxRequestToGrantTime
uint32_t
tx के अनुरोध के आधार पर इस्तेमाल करने में लगने वाला औसत समय.
mNumGrantGlitch
uint32_t
अनुमति से जुड़ी समस्याओं की संख्या.
mNumRxDelayedGrant
uint32_t
ऐसे rx अनुरोधों की संख्या जिन्हें 50us के अंदर स्वीकार नहीं किया गया था.
mNumRxGrantDeactivatedDuringRequest
uint32_t
उन rx की संख्या जो अनुदान के बंद होने के दौरान काम कर रहे थे.
mNumRxGrantImmediate
uint32_t
अनुदान के चालू रहने के दौरान rx अनुरोधों की संख्या.
mNumRxGrantNone
uint32_t
अनुदान पाए बिना पूरे किए गए rx अनुरोधों की संख्या.
mNumRxGrantWait
uint32_t
अनुदान निष्क्रिय होने के दौरान rx अनुरोधों की संख्या.
mNumRxGrantWaitActivated
uint32_t
अनुदान के निष्क्रिय होने के दौरान rx अनुरोधों की संख्या, जो आखिरकार स्वीकार कर लिए गए.
mNumRxGrantWaitTimeout
uint32_t
अनुदान के निष्क्रिय होने के दौरान rx अनुरोधों की संख्या जिसका समय खत्म हो गया.
mNumRxRequest
uint32_t
rx अनुरोधों की संख्या.
mNumTxDelayedGrant
uint32_t
ऐसे tx अनुरोधों की संख्या जिन्हें 50us के अंदर स्वीकार नहीं किया गया था.
mNumTxGrantDeactivatedDuringRequest
uint32_t
उन tx की संख्या जो अनुदान के बंद होने के दौरान काम कर रहे थे.
mNumTxGrantImmediate
uint32_t
अनुदान के चालू रहने के दौरान tx अनुरोधों की संख्या.
mNumTxGrantWait
uint32_t
अनुदान प्रयोग में नहीं होने के दौरान tx अनुरोधों की संख्या.
mNumTxGrantWaitActivated
uint32_t
अनुदान के निष्क्रिय रहने के दौरान tx अनुरोधों की संख्या, जो आखिरकार स्वीकार कर ली गई.
mNumTxGrantWaitTimeout
uint32_t
अनुमति के बंद रहने के दौरान tx अनुरोधों की संख्या, जिसकी समय सीमा खत्म हो गई.
mNumTxRequest
uint32_t
tx अनुरोधों की संख्या.
mStopped
bool
डेटा को गहरा या फीका करने की वजह से, आंकड़ों का कलेक्शन बंद हो गया है.

सार्वजनिक एट्रिब्यूट

mAvgRxRequestToGrantTime

uint32_t otRadioCoexMetrics::mAvgRxRequestToGrantTime

देने के लिए rx अनुरोध के उपयोगc में औसत समय.

mAvgTxRequestToGrantTime

uint32_t otRadioCoexMetrics::mAvgTxRequestToGrantTime

tx के अनुरोध के आधार पर इस्तेमाल करने में लगने वाला औसत समय.

mNumGrantGlitch

uint32_t otRadioCoexMetrics::mNumGrantGlitch

अनुमति से जुड़ी समस्याओं की संख्या.

mNumRxDelayedGrant

uint32_t otRadioCoexMetrics::mNumRxDelayedGrant

ऐसे rx अनुरोधों की संख्या जिन्हें 50us के अंदर स्वीकार नहीं किया गया था.

mNumRxGrantDeactivatedDuringRequest

uint32_t otRadioCoexMetrics::mNumRxGrantDeactivatedDuringRequest

उन rx की संख्या जो अनुदान के बंद होने के दौरान काम कर रहे थे.

mNumRxGrantImmediate

uint32_t otRadioCoexMetrics::mNumRxGrantImmediate

अनुदान के चालू रहने के दौरान rx अनुरोधों की संख्या.

mNumRxGrantNone

uint32_t otRadioCoexMetrics::mNumRxGrantNone

अनुदान पाए बिना पूरे किए गए rx अनुरोधों की संख्या.

mNumRxGrantWait

uint32_t otRadioCoexMetrics::mNumRxGrantWait

अनुदान निष्क्रिय होने के दौरान rx अनुरोधों की संख्या.

mNumRxGrantWaitActivated

uint32_t otRadioCoexMetrics::mNumRxGrantWaitActivated

अनुदान के निष्क्रिय होने के दौरान rx अनुरोधों की संख्या, जो आखिरकार स्वीकार कर लिए गए.

mNumRxGrantWaitTimeout

uint32_t otRadioCoexMetrics::mNumRxGrantWaitTimeout

अनुदान के निष्क्रिय होने के दौरान rx अनुरोधों की संख्या जिसका समय खत्म हो गया.

mNumRxRequest

uint32_t otRadioCoexMetrics::mNumRxRequest

rx अनुरोधों की संख्या.

mNumTxDelayedGrant

uint32_t otRadioCoexMetrics::mNumTxDelayedGrant

ऐसे tx अनुरोधों की संख्या जिन्हें 50us के अंदर स्वीकार नहीं किया गया था.

mNumTxGrantDeactivatedDuringRequest

uint32_t otRadioCoexMetrics::mNumTxGrantDeactivatedDuringRequest

उन tx की संख्या जो अनुदान के बंद होने के दौरान काम कर रहे थे.

mNumTxGrantImmediate

uint32_t otRadioCoexMetrics::mNumTxGrantImmediate

अनुदान के चालू रहने के दौरान tx अनुरोधों की संख्या.

mNumTxGrantWait

uint32_t otRadioCoexMetrics::mNumTxGrantWait

अनुदान प्रयोग में नहीं होने के दौरान tx अनुरोधों की संख्या.

mNumTxGrantWaitActivated

uint32_t otRadioCoexMetrics::mNumTxGrantWaitActivated

अनुदान के निष्क्रिय रहने के दौरान tx अनुरोधों की संख्या, जो आखिरकार स्वीकार कर ली गई.

mNumTxGrantWaitTimeout

uint32_t otRadioCoexMetrics::mNumTxGrantWaitTimeout

अनुमति के बंद रहने के दौरान tx अनुरोधों की संख्या, जिसकी समय सीमा खत्म हो गई.

mNumTxRequest

uint32_t otRadioCoexMetrics::mNumTxRequest

tx अनुरोधों की संख्या.

mStopped

bool otRadioCoexMetrics::mStopped

डेटा को गहरा या फीका करने की वजह से, आंकड़ों का कलेक्शन बंद हो गया है.

संसाधन

OpenThread API के रेफ़रंस के विषय, सोर्स कोड से मिलते हैं. यह सोर्स GitHub पर उपलब्ध है. ज़्यादा जानकारी या हमारे दस्तावेज़ में योगदान देने के लिए, संसाधन देखें.